Taxonomic Classification
| Rank | Asiatic black bear | Azorean predacious diving beetle |
|---|---|---|
| Kingdom same | Animalia (Animals) | Animalia (Animals) |
| Phylum | Chordata (Chordates) | Arthropoda (Arthropods) |
| Class | Mammalia (Mammals) | Insecta (Insects) |
| Order | Carnivora (Carnivorans) | Coleoptera (Beetles) |
| Family | Ursidae (Bears) | Dytiscidae |
| Genus | Ursus (Bears) | Agabus |
| Species | Ursus thibetanus | Agabus godmanni |
